    🔑 Key Takeaways:

    • Most pet surrender begins before the shelter. Families are usually out of options, not out of love. The prevention work has to happen upstream of the surrender call, not after it.
    • Fragmented systems are the real bottleneck. Shelters, rescues, vets, landlords, and community orgs are all working the same families separately. A shared operational layer (like the Animal Welfare Resource Network (AWRN) https://animal-angelsfoundation.org/AWRN.html lets partners work the case together instead of duplicating each other or losing the family in the gap.
    • Prevention is measurable, fundable, and scalable. Every prevented intake costs a fraction of an absorbed one. Once you have the data, the story shifts from ""rescue heroes"" to ""system builders,"" and that opens up municipal, sponsor, and grant funding that traditional shelter messaging cannot.
